Transaction 012ed3437893102dbbc8b5b873d107cf57c88cf2965f3fb14c3a592f71578210
1 Input
1 Output
-
012ed3437893102dbbc8b5b873d107cf57c88cf2965f3fb14c3a592f71578210:0
- value
- 12190665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b8756ac08a27b925a4f565d7da194ec87d09094 OP_EQUAL
- address
- 34CaJDDFJLGvRzTcjre4RtvQuYZ5p62t5F